This area of science deals with the behaviour of physical bodies when subjected to forces or displacements, and the subsequent effects of the bodies on their environment. Mechanics has origin in the ancient period. Scientists such as Galileo, Kepler and Newton laid the foundation of classical mechanics, which deals with the particles that are either at rest or are moving with velocities significantly less than the speed of light
